Posted on 7/4/16 at 7:01 pm to BallHawk
It would be 10.2 mil over 3 seasons. Basically, his cap charge gets reduced to 3.4 this year, giving up between 9-13 to spend, plus the Room. Would have 3.4 in dead money on the books the next two years, when the cap is projected to be 105-110 million, so thats just 3% of the cap. Won't kill you.
But, for a money conscious team, would it be better to give up picks to just dump him? You don't have to pay the money, period. Basically, they would be selling a future pick or two for 10 million and opening up space this year.
No good options here.
